The PR-LEAPS Project envisions the following goals:
(G1) Positively impact secondary level English and history teachers from schools in the Humacao area, both public and private, to participate in the PR-LEAPS Project.
(G2) Facilitate the professional development of 20 teachers from the public and private school system in the Humacao area to maximize the use of the Library of Congress’s online primary sources to develop ESL competencies and researching skills of students at the secondary level.
(G3) Facilitate participant’s strategic planning in using Library of Congress’s primary sources to create educational materials that build reading, writing, speaking, listening and researching skills for ESL learners.
(G4) Positively impact students from the public and private school sectors of the Humacao area in their academic achievement by using the Library of Congress’s primary sources to develop English competencies and research skills.
(G5) Disseminate and distribute educational materials developed through the PR-LEAPS Project to promote teaching with primary sources from the Library of Congress. In order to meet these goal, Faculty of the English Department, the Distance Education Office (EaD) Staff, and PRDE public and private schools in Humacao, will participate actively in the four (4) different phases of the PR- LEAPS Project.
